@5:17 "You have your dual zone climate controls in the center..." That center knob is not part of the "dual zone climate controls" That center knob is the fan speed. The knobs to the left and right of the center knob are for driver and passenger temperature choices. @5:32 "You just push down on D for drive..." No, you do not just push down on D for drive. First, you must have your foot pressing on the brake pedal, and while your foot is pressing on the brake pedal, that is when you press D, or N, etc. And a few seconds later, he states that you just push P to put it into park. Wrong. Same as above. @5:50 "...for wide view and narrow view..." referring to the rearview camera. Wrong. The views are: -- Wide view. -- Very wide view. -- Close up view. Also, know that the stereo is so-so. It is nothing special. You can enjoy it, but it is not up to the level of the rest of the car. The Toyota Camry and Nissan Altima stereos are of similar sound quality. It seems as though the three companies had a meeting and all decided to cut corners on the sound quality of their stereos. Even for the cars that offer premium stereos, the "premium" basically translates into "louder".
